3 Typical Causes of Water Spots on Wall Surfaces


In contrast to popular belief, water discolorations on walls do not constantly come from inadequate structure materials. There are a number of root causes of water spots on wall surfaces. These include:

 

Poor Water drainage


This will certainly prevent water from leaking right into the wall surfaces. This links to extreme dampness that you notice on the walls of your building.
The leading reason of damp walls, in this instance, can be a poor drain system. It can also be due to bad management of sewage pipelines that run through the structure.

 

Moist


When hot moist air consults with dry cold air, it creates water beads to form on the wall surfaces of buildings. This happens in bathroom and kitchens when there is heavy steam from cooking or showers. The water droplets can stain the bordering walls in these parts of your residence and spread to other areas.
Wet or condensation influences the roof and walls of structures. When the wall is damp, it develops an appropriate setting for the development of fungis and microbes.

 

Pipeline Leaks


The majority of homes have a network of water pipes within the wall surfaces. It always boosts the feasibility of such pipes, as there is little oxygen within the walls.
Yet, a drawback to this is that water leakage affects the walls of the structure and also triggers widespread damages. A dead giveaway of faulty pipes is the appearance of a water stain on the wall.

 

Water Spots on Wall Surface: Repair Tips


House owners would typically want a quick fix when dealing with water stains. Yet, they would quickly understand this is detrimental as the water spots recur. So, here are a couple of practical pointers that will certainly guide you in the repair work of water stains on wall surfaces:

 

  • Always repair the cause of water discolorations on walls

  • Involve the help of professional repair services

  • Method regular hygiene and also clear out stopped up sewage systems

  • When developing a home in a waterlogged area, make sure that the employees carry out appropriate grading

  • Tiling areas that are prone to high condensation, such as the kitchen and bathroom, assists in reducing the accumulation of damp

  • Dehumidifiers are likewise practical in maintaining the moisture levels at bay

How to Remove Water Stains From Your Walls Without Repainting

 

The easy way to get water stains off walls

 

Water stains aren’t going to appear on tile; they need a more absorbent surface, which is why they show up on bare walls. Since your walls are probably painted, this presents a problem: How can you wash a wall without damaging it and risk needing to repait the entire room?

 

According to Igloo Surfaces, you should start gently and only increase the intensity of your cleaning methods if basic remedies don’t get the job done. Start with a simple solution of dish soap and warm water, at a ratio of about one to two. Use a cloth dipped in the mixture to apply the soapy water to your stain. Gently rub it in from the top down, then rinse with plain water and dry thoroughly with a hair dryer on a cool setting.


If that doesn’t work, fill a spray bottle with a mixture of vinegar, lemon juice, and baking soda. Shake it up and spray it on the stain. Leave it for about an hour, then use a damp cloth to rub it away. You may have to repeat this process a few times to get the stain all the way out, so do this when you have time for multiple hour-long soaking intervals.

 

How to get water stains out of wood

 

Maybe you have wood paneling or cabinets that are looking grody from water stains too, whether in your kitchen or bathroom. Per Better Homes and Gardens, you have a few options for removing water marks on your wooden surfaces.

 
  • You can let mayonnaise sit on your stain overnight, then wipe it away in the morning and polish your wood afterward.


  •  
  • You can also mix equal parts vinegar and olive oil and apply to the stain with a cloth, wiping in the direction of the grain until the stain disappears. Afterward, wipe the surface down with a clean, dry cloth.


  •  
  • Try placing an iron on a low heat setting over a cloth on top of the stain. Press it down for a few seconds and remove it to see if the stain is letting up, then try again until you’re satisfied. (Be advised that this works best for still-damp stains.)
